Glyde-Saf™ HD is capable of unlimited runs with an overall span length of 50 ft. (15.2m), and allows less fall clearance as compared to a wire cable system. The system allows for longer spans without sag between supports, providing a reliable, cost-effective way to reduce the risk of injury while working at heights. Key features: High grade steel construction. 2-user rated, 420 lbs. (190.5 kg) / user. Max allowable span is 50 ft. (15.2m). Allowable 6 ft. (1.8m) cantilever.

A simpe and versatile horizontal system specifically designed for multiple applications. It connects to rebar on prestressed concrete beams, shear connector studs or directly to steel I-beams with an optional adaptor. The system fits 3/4" dia. shear connector studs, most rebar configurations, #3 to #6 rebar and both 2 1/2" to 12" center to center, and I-beams with flange widths of 10" to 25" and 1/2" to 3" thick.

Unlike acceleration-based seatbelt technology used in other self-retracting lifelines, the Talon Self-Retracting Lifeline uses new technology based on velocity. This eliminates the problem of simple movement causing false locking, often experienced when using other self-retracting lifelines. The Talon has an all-metal braking system with an anti-ratcheting dual pawl design. The pawls operate independently for greater safety.
